Caribbean

Antigua and Barbuda
Antigua and Barbuda
Trinidad and Tobago
Grenada
Saint Kitts and Nevis
Saint Kitts and Nevis
Guyana
Trinidad and Tobago

2025-02-10 15:57:49

Monika Walker

Trinidad and Tobago
Dominica
Trinidad and Tobago